Ionia city, Michigan: commercial real estate data.

Ionia city is a Census city of 12,753 people across 5.41 square miles of land, in Ionia County. Median household income is $63,978, 59.6 percent of occupied homes are owned, and the SBA record carries 13 7(a) approvals to borrowers here worth $3.1 m.

How many people live in Ionia, Michigan?

12,753, in 3,939 households. Ionia city covers 5.41 square miles of land, which is 2,357 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Ionia in?

Ionia County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Ionia?

$63,978.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$164,800. Median gross rent is $852 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

How much SBA lending goes to Ionia businesses?

13 7(a) approvals totalling $3.1 m, across 6 lenders, median approval $100,000, plus 3 504 approvals worth $1.3 m. These count approvals to borrowers whose address is in Ionia, not projects sited inside the place boundary, and they are approvals recorded in the release rather than loans disbursed.
